Summary : Continuously update packages from devel:openQA
Description :
Use this package to install and enable a systemd service for continuously
upgrading the system if devel:openQA packages are stable and contain updates. It
is complementary to auto-update which also reboots the system and does updates
regardless of whether devel:openQA contains updates.
